Transaction 39b904125931a9d33291c6225c129c92b410fc1950025609425307d1d6599926
1 Input
1 Output
-
39b904125931a9d33291c6225c129c92b410fc1950025609425307d1d6599926:0
- value
- 43373310
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6f50360b0aa50fc0f7b10cdfe01b6d8e4296f0a8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1B9a6TbUbRyYVMTFa4dRLBNeimvCSLmv6S